T-Rex_80 Posted November 21, 2023 Share Posted November 21, 2023 Hello! I just started a new map and got a cool steam vent in very close proximity to my base. I am wondering what the best approach would be if I want to tame the vent and use both water and steam? psusi Posted November 21, 2023 Share Posted November 21, 2023 Wall it off and cover it with water to stop it from erupting so it doesn't cook your base until you can build an ST/AT to cool it. Or maybe just start over on a less bad map. Getting an open steam vent that isn't dormant right away like that is harsh. You may not even be able to get dupes in to wall it off without being scalded to death. cyberwarlord Posted November 21, 2023 Share Posted November 21, 2023 Seal it off immediately to stop the heat an drown the vent could use it to make an A/c for the base, heat dump. Could also make a oil pipe loop for a refiner to heat the steam. If you surround it with a vacuum you can add a aquatuner and make a cold box near by for food storage. Cooling the water takes a decent amount of power but may be necessary if it's your only water. Recommend getting solar or geothermal quickly. Or phosphorus an weezewort. Double oil liquid lock for a clean industrial brick would be my choice. Keeps the room temp stable and pressurized. Start making glass. Ceramics. Metals. If you keep it pressurized you can make oxylite or bleach stone. Also great for advanced materials fabrication or geotuners. Using the hot water for hydrogen an oxygen is the best use. blakemw Posted November 22, 2023 Share Posted November 22, 2023 In this scenario I'd be very happy, because I love having clean water sources near the base. The Super Computer, Microbe Musher, Algae Terrarium are all perfectly happy being fed hot water which allows saving the cool water for things like Bristle Blossom. To address the heating, I would research Insulated Tiles pretty fast, they aren't high tech, and then build a wall of insulated tiles, roughly as shown by the orange lines: There's no need to completely encircle the area, because it takes heat a long time to leak through a lot of terrain. And I leave it open on the far side so the terrain can condense the steam. Once it goes dormant it can be formally tamed. Hopefully it goes without saying, that while the heat leaking into the terrain isn't going to be a problem in general, don't make your Bristle Blossom farms right where the heat is leaking out, like the heat is not going to be a problem as in it's not going to scald dupes or anything like that but it'll still climb to something like 50 C. Gurgel Posted November 23, 2023 Share Posted November 23, 2023 To answer the original question: Steam at this temperature is pretty useless. What you do to use the water is the same you do for all hot water: You cool it down or you use it in an anti-SPOM to generate Hydrogen. I recently built some anti-SPOMs again with the original design and they still work very nicely and are highly efficient.
